The owner, a gardening enthusiast who has lived in the United States, is deeply fond of the American country garden style and also appreciates the gravel-and-plant aesthetic of southern France. This project harmoniously integrates these elements within a lush Chinese setting, creating an atmosphere of imperfect perfection—a celebration of natural beauty, time-worn texture, and effortless comfort.
The garden is envisioned as a warm, laid-back outdoor living room where family and friends can gather, dine, and share life. Rather than pursuing rigid symmetry, the design emphasizes organic flow and life’s gentle traces. The central gathering area, with an outdoor grill and weather-resistant wooden furniture, forms an open “outdoor kitchen and living room.” Along the fishpond, a quiet corner with soft seating offers a serene retreat. Low cultural stone walls, wooden fences, beige gravel, and perennial flower beds define boundaries while maintaining openness and dialogue with the surrounding environment.
The atmosphere evokes the scent of soil, sunlight, and freshly baked bread, blending the warmth of ovens, the simplicity of cultural stones, and the elegance of olive trees. Smart systems—including automatic irrigation, mosquito control, lighting, and fishpond filtration—are integrated with the home’s intelligent system, minimizing maintenance and enabling remote management.
Sustainability is embedded throughout the design. Rainwater and filtered pond water are reused for irrigation, reducing tap water use by over 50%. Drought-tolerant native species and drip irrigation conserve water and maintain soil moisture. Environmentally friendly materials such as recyclable stones and repurposed pottery reduce waste, while layered plant communities attract birds, bees, and butterflies, enhancing ecological diversity and natural pest control.
